区块链技术作为一种创新的分布式账本技术,允许多个参与者在没有中介的情况下进行交易或数据交换。而在实际应用中,企业通常会采用多种区块链解决方案来满足不同的需求,这就导致了不同区块链之间的互操作性问题。因此,制定统一的区块链集成标准显得尤为重要。
标准化不仅能够促进不同系统之间的协作,降低开发和维护成本,还可以增强安全性和可靠性。然而,实施这些标准的挑战也不容小觑,包括技术的复杂性、缺乏统一的行业标准和对数据隐私的考量等。
### 区块链集成标准的基本要求 #### 1. 互操作性互操作性是区块链集成标准中最为核心的要求。不同的区块链网络必须能够无缝地交换信息,并且保持数据的完整性和一致性。这意味着需要制定协议和接口,使得不同区块链间的数据可以相互识别和兼容。
实现互操作性的一个常见方法是使用跨链技术。例如,Polkadot和Cosmos等项目通过创建能够连接不同区块链的中间层,以实现信息和价值的自由流动。
#### 2. 安全性安全性是任何区块链应用的首要考量。集成标准必须确保所有参与方的身份验证和授权机制是高度安全的,以防止恶意攻击和数据泄露。这包括采用加密技术、智能合约审核和多重签名等安全措施。
此外,在信息共享和数据交换过程中,确保数据的隐私同样至关重要。行业标准应当考虑到各种法规和合规要求,例如GDPR(通用数据保护条例),以确保用户的数据得到妥善处理。
#### 3. 可扩展性随着用户数量的增加,区块链网络需要很强的可扩展性以处理更多的交易和数据。区块链集成标准必须考虑到这一点,旨在设计高度可扩展的系统架构。
如比特币和以太坊等传统区块链在交易处理能力上受到限制,而一些新兴的区块链,例如Solana和Polygon则通过采用不同的共识机制和层次结构提高了可扩展性。因此,集成方案应当允许根据需求动态调整性能。
#### 4. 标准化的数据格式为了实现不同区块链之间的高效集成,必须制定统一的数据格式。这将简化数据交换的过程,并减少因格式不兼容所导致的技术障碍。
例如,使用JSON或XML等通用数据格式可以提升不同区块链系统的数据兼容性。此外,标准化的数据结构和API接口也有助于进一步提高集成的效率和可维护性。
#### 5. 共识机制的兼容性不同的区块链采用了不同的共识机制,例如工作量证明(PoW)、权益证明(PoS)等。为了实现集成,各个区块链的共识机制必须能够相互协作,确保集成后的系统依然保持高效和安全。
例如,在一个包含多个区块链的生态系统中,可能需要设计一种“中介”的共识机制,使得来自不同区块链的事务能够在一个共同的环境下进行验证和处理,这样的设计可能会涉及深厚的技术研究和标准化工作。
### 可能相关的问题 1. **区块链集成时面临的主要技术挑战有哪些?** 2. **如何确保区块链集成的安全性和共识机制的兼容性?** 3. **在不同的行业中,区块链集成标准的应用案例是什么?** 4. **企业如何评估和选择合适的区块链集成解决方案?** 5. **未来区块链集成标准的发展趋势是什么?** ### 区块链集成时面临的主要技术挑战有哪些?技术挑战的多样性
区块链集成过程中,技术挑战多种多样,这些挑战主要体现在互操作性、安全性、可扩展性、数据治理和标准化等方面。
互操作性问题
首先,不同区块链间的互操作性是一个主要挑战。不同区块链使用不同的技术栈和协议,使得它们之间的通信变得复杂。比如,比特币和以太坊在价值转移和智能合约方面的实现方式迥异。因此,找到一种通用的解决方案来实现数据和价值的流转是非常困难的。
安全性风险
其次,集成过程中的安全性风险大大增加。一个脆弱的接口或者协议都可能成为黑客攻击的目标。一旦攻击成功,可能会导致数据丢失、财务损失等严重后果。因此,确保每个接口和节点的安全性至关重要。
可扩展性问题
可扩展性也是一个主要问题。在集成多个区块链的情况下,如何保证系统能够支持大量的数据和交易也是一个技术上的挑战。一些传统的区块链在面对高负载时可能会出现延迟和性能下降,因此需要设计出更具有弹性的系统架构。
数据治理和标准化
区块链集成还涉及到数据治理的问题。如何对不同来源的数据进行标准化处理,以及如何确保数据的一致性和准确性,都是需要解决的技术挑战。此外,目前尚未形成统一的行业标准,不同技术方案的竞争使得标准化变得更加复杂。
### 如何确保区块链集成的安全性和共识机制的兼容性?安全性的重要性
区块链系统的安全性是它成功实施的基石。任何安全漏洞都可能导致整个网络的崩溃或数据的泄露。因此,在进行区块链集成时,必须采取一系列的安全措施以确保整体系统的安全性。
身份验证和权限管理
首先,身份验证是确保安全的重要环节。通过使用公钥基础设施(PKI)、多重签名和分布式身份(DID)等技术手段,能够增强参与者的身份验证安全性。无论是个人用户还是企业,都必须经过严格的身份验证,才能进行数据交换或交易。
共识机制的设计
在集成不同的区块链时,确保共识机制的兼容性也是一个重要考量。不同区块链的共识机制之间存在重大差异,例如比特币采用工作量证明机制,而以太坊已经转向权益证明机制。在设计集成架构时,需要考虑引入一种能够兼容多种共识机制的设计方案,这通常需要较高的技术精力和时间投入。
加密技术的应用
另外,加密技术的应用同样至关重要。传统的对称和非对称加密算法应当被广泛采用,以确保数据传输过程中的安全性。同时,零知识证明、同态加密等新兴的加密技术也将在区块链集成中发挥越来越重要的作用,为数据隐私保驾护航。
智能合约的审核
最后,智能合约的审核也是必要的步骤。许多安全问题往往源于智能合约的错误代码,因此在上线之前进行全面的审核及测试,将大大降低潜在的安全风险。
### 在不同的行业中,区块链集成标准的应用案例是什么?金融行业的典型案例
在金融行业,区块链集成的应用案例已经取得了一定的成功,例如跨境支付系统。在这一领域,通过集成不同国家和银行的区块链系统,可以大幅提升交易效率,并且减少中介成本。例如,Ripple旨在通过其网络实现全球范围内快速且成本低廉的跨境支付。
供应链管理的应用
供应链管理也是区块链集成的重要应用领域。例如,IBM Food Trust和沃尔玛的合作,通过集成多个参与者的区块链系统,确保食品的源头可追溯性,加强了食品安全监管。此外,这一系统还能够极大提高整个供应链的透明度,库存管理。
医疗健康领域
在医疗健康领域,区块链集成案例同样值得关注。例如,MediLedger是一个试图整合药品供应链的项目,通过区块链技术实现药品的可追溯性,并确保数据的安全和隐私保护。这种集成能够帮助减少假药流通,提升用药安全性。
政府和公共服务
在政府和公共服务方面,区块链集成的实例则较为新颖。某些国家和地区正在探索区块链在电子投票、土地注册和身份认证等领域的应用,通过集成不同的区块链系统,提高行政效率,减少腐败和舞弊现象。
文化创意产业
文化创意产业同样受益于区块链的集成标准。例如,某些平台通过区块链集成艺术作品的确权和交易,从而保护创作者的知识产权并实现艺术品的溯源。
### 企业如何评估和选择合适的区块链集成解决方案?评估标准的多维度性
在选择适合的区块链集成解决方案时,企业需要从多个维度进行评估,包括技术的适用性、成本、可扩展性、社区支持等。
技术适用性
首先,企业需要考虑解决方案的技术适用性。它必须能满足企业特定的业务需求,如交易速度、数据存储容量和互操作性。为此,企业可以进行一些初步的技术测试,检验各个可能的方案在实际操作中的表现。
成本效益分析
其次,进行成本效益分析也是重要的一步。企业需要全面评估所有相关成本,包括软件开发、基础设施建设以及后续的运维成本。同时,也要结合未来的收益预期和投资回报率(ROI)进行全面的评估,确保选择的方案具有经济上的合理性。
可扩展性考虑
可扩展性的考虑同样不可忽视,企业在选择集成解决方案时应评估其未来的扩展能力。在快速发展的市场环境下,能够支持不断变化需求的系统架构,是企业获得竞争优势的关键。
社区和技术支持
最后,技术社区的支持也是评估过程中不可或缺的一部分。活跃的社群不仅能够提供最新的技术支持,还能确保项目在开发过程中的快速响应,并且能及时解决技术难题。因此,在选择方案时,也要关注其背后支持团队的规模和活跃度。
### 未来区块链集成标准的发展趋势是什么?行业整合与标准化的趋势
未来区块链集成标准的发展将主要朝着更强的行业整合和更高的标准化方向努力。随着企业对区块链技术的接受度提升,行业合作将会更加紧密,促使不同区块链之间的相互集成。
技术演进与智能合约的普及
技术的不断演进也是一大趋势,特别是智能合约技术的普及将会促进区块链集成的同步标准化。随着智能合约开发工具和平台的不断完善,企业将更容易创建符合行业标准的集成解决方案。
政策与法规的推动
政策与法规的推动也将对区块链集成标准的发展产生深远影响。各国政府和行业组织将通过制定相关法律法规,引导各方参与者采纳统一的集成标准,从而保障整体市场的有序发展。
开放式生态系统的构建
最后,未来的趋势还包括构建开放式生态系统。通过开放API和标准接口,提供更多的互联互通机会,不仅能够促进资源共享,还能激活各方的创新潜力,推动区块链技术的更广泛应用。
总之,随着区块链技术的快速发展,建立标准化的集成解决方案对于确保其有效应用至关重要。通过深入理解相关的技术挑战、行业应用和未来趋势,企业和开发者将能够更好地应对区块链集成中的各项要求,为数字化转型和创新铺平道路。